Often, the initial reaction to discovering a kidney stone is anxiety. You might be wondering about the pain, the potential for complications, and the necessity of invasive procedures. However, many small kidney stones can pass on their own with minimal intervention. This is where conservative management comes into play. It’s crucial to remember that hydration is paramount. Drinking plenty of water helps flush the urinary system and encourages the stone to move along. Your doctor may also prescribe pain relievers and alpha-blockers, medications that relax the muscles in your ureter, making it easier for the stone to pass.
However, not all stones are created equal. Larger stones, or those causing significant pain or obstruction, often require more aggressive treatment. The type of stone also plays a critical role. Knowing whether you’re dealing with calcium oxalate, uric acid, struvite, or cystine stones informs the treatment strategy and preventative measures. A thorough analysis of the passed stone (if possible) or a 24-hour urine collection can help determine the stone’s composition. This diagnostic precision is vital for tailoring a treatment plan that addresses the root cause of your kidney stones.

Understanding Kidney Stone Types & Their Impact on Treatment
Different types of kidney stones respond differently to various treatments. Calcium oxalate stones, the most common type, often require increased fluid intake and dietary modifications. Uric acid stones, frequently associated with gout, may benefit from medications that lower uric acid levels. Struvite stones, often linked to urinary tract infections, typically necessitate addressing the underlying infection and potentially surgical removal. Cystine stones, a rarer type, often require a combination of high fluid intake, medications, and sometimes, surgical intervention. Identifying the stone type is therefore a cornerstone of effective treatment.
Your doctor will likely order a urinalysis to check for infection and crystal types. Blood tests can assess your kidney function and identify any underlying metabolic abnormalities. Imaging studies, such as a CT scan or X-ray, are essential for determining the size and location of the stone. These diagnostic tools provide a comprehensive picture of your condition, allowing your healthcare team to develop a personalized treatment plan.
The Role of Stone Size in Treatment Decisions
Generally, stones smaller than 5 millimeters have a good chance of passing on their own with conservative management. Stones between 5 and 10 millimeters may require medical expulsive therapy (MET) – a combination of pain relievers and alpha-blockers – to facilitate passage. Stones larger than 10 millimeters often necessitate intervention. However, these are general guidelines, and individual factors can influence the decision.
The location of the stone also matters. Stones lodged in the ureter, the tube connecting the kidney to the bladder, are more likely to cause pain and obstruction than stones remaining within the kidney. This is because the ureter is narrower and less able to accommodate a stone.
Extracorporeal Shock Wave Lithotripsy (ESWL): A Non-Invasive Option
ESWL is a non-invasive procedure that uses shock waves to break the kidney stone into smaller fragments that can be passed more easily. You’ll likely experience some discomfort during the procedure, but it’s generally well-tolerated. ESWL is often a good option for stones in the kidney or upper ureter. However, it’s not suitable for all stones, particularly very large or hard stones.
Potential side effects of ESWL include bruising, hematoma (blood collection under the skin), and temporary kidney damage. Your doctor will carefully evaluate your individual case to determine if ESWL is the right choice for you. “ESWL represents a significant advancement in kidney stone management, offering a less invasive alternative to surgery.”
Ureteroscopy: A Minimally Invasive Approach
Ureteroscopy involves inserting a thin, flexible scope through the urethra and bladder into the ureter. The surgeon can then visualize the stone and use laser energy or a basket to remove or break it into smaller pieces. Ureteroscopy is effective for stones of various sizes and locations.
This procedure is typically performed under anesthesia. You may experience some discomfort and blood in your urine for a few days after the procedure. However, recovery is generally quick, and most patients can return to their normal activities within a week.
Percutaneous Nephrolithotomy (PCNL): For Larger, More Complex Stones
PCNL is a minimally invasive surgical procedure used to remove larger or more complex kidney stones. It involves making a small incision in your back and inserting a scope directly into the kidney. The surgeon then uses ultrasound or fluoroscopy to locate the stone and break it into smaller pieces for removal.
PCNL is typically reserved for stones that are too large or difficult to treat with ESWL or ureteroscopy. It requires a longer recovery time than other procedures, but it’s often the most effective option for large stones.
Dietary Modifications & Prevention: Reducing Your Risk
Once you’ve successfully treated a kidney stone, preventing future occurrences is crucial. Dietary modifications play a significant role. If you have calcium oxalate stones, increasing your fluid intake and limiting your intake of oxalate-rich foods (such as spinach, rhubarb, and chocolate) can help. If you have uric acid stones, reducing your intake of purine-rich foods (such as red meat and organ meats) may be beneficial.
Your doctor may also recommend medications to help prevent stone formation. These medications can help lower uric acid levels, reduce calcium excretion, or increase citrate levels in your urine.
Comparing Treatment Options: A Quick Reference
| Treatment Option | Stone Size | Stone Type | Invasiveness | Recovery Time |
|---|---|---|---|---|
| Conservative Management | < 5mm | All | Non-invasive | Days |
| ESWL | 5-10mm | Calcium Oxalate, Uric Acid | Non-invasive | Days to Weeks |
| Ureteroscopy | 5-20mm | All | Minimally Invasive | Days to Weeks |
| PCNL | >20mm | All | Minimally Invasive | Weeks |
The Importance of Follow-Up Care
After kidney stone treatment, regular follow-up appointments with your doctor are essential. These appointments allow your doctor to monitor your kidney function, assess for any complications, and discuss preventative measures. You may need to undergo periodic urine tests and imaging studies to ensure that new stones aren’t forming.
Don’t hesitate to contact your doctor if you experience any symptoms, such as pain, fever, or blood in your urine. Early detection and treatment of any complications can help prevent long-term kidney damage.
